ð° Carcassonne Castle: Franceâs Timeless Medieval Treasure
ðĄïļ A Fortress Through the Ages
Carcassonne Castle, perched in southern Franceâs Occitanie region, stands as a remarkable example of medieval fortification. Its origins reach back to ancient times, with Roman and Visigoth influences shaping its unique structure. The castleâs impressive walls and towers, dating mainly from the 13th century, showcase masterful craftsmanship designed to protect and preserve the community within.
ð° Architectural Marvels
The castle blends Roman and medieval styles, featuring the elegant ChÃĒteau Comtalâthe historic residence of regional leadersâand the stunning Basilica of Saint-Nazaire. This Romanesque-Gothic cathedral captivates visitors with its colorful stained glass and exquisite stone carvings, reflecting centuries of cultural heritage.
ðĄïļ Strategic and Cultural Significance
Overlooking the scenic Aude River, Carcassonne has long been a vital hub connecting regions and fostering trade and cultural exchange. Its fortifications have safeguarded this vibrant community through many eras, preserving a living history that invites visitors to step back in time.
âĻ UNESCO World Heritage Status
In 1997, Carcassonne was honored as a UNESCO World Heritage Site, celebrated for its exceptional preservation and as a symbol of medieval architectural brilliance. Today, it continues to inspire travelers and history enthusiasts worldwide.

ð Tatra Mountains, Zakopane, Poland
Nestled at the foot of the majestic Tatra Mountains, Zakopane is Poland's premier mountain resort, offering a blend of natural beauty, rich culture, and year-round activities. The Tatra range, the highest in Poland, boasts dramatic peaks, alpine lakes, and deep valleys, making it a haven for outdoor enthusiasts and nature lovers alike.
Hiking & Mountaineering: Explore the numerous trails ranging from easy walks to challenging climbs. Popular hikes include routes to Morskie Oko, a stunning glacial lake, and summits like Rysy, the highest peak in Poland.
Skiing & Snowboarding: In winter, Zakopane transforms into a ski resort with various slopes catering to all levels. The Kasprowy Wierch cable car offers access to alpine terrain.
Cultural Experiences: Visit the Tatra Museum to learn about the region's history and culture. Stroll down KrupÃģwki Street, lined with shops, restaurants, and traditional wooden architecture.
Summer (June to August): Ideal for hiking, sightseeing, and enjoying the vibrant local festivals.
Winter (December to February): Perfect for skiing, snowboarding, and experiencing the winter charm of the mountains.
Travel Tip: Zakopane is approximately a 2.5 to 4-hour train journey from KrakÃģw, offering scenic views along the way. The town is also accessible by bus and car.

ð Mammoth Skeleton: A Glimpse into Prehistoric Giants
ðļ This striking image captures a mammoth skeleton displayed in a museum, offering a window into the distant past. Mammoths, relatives of today's elephants, roamed the Earth during the Pleistocene Epoch. Their massive size and distinctive curved tusks make them iconic symbols of prehistoric megafauna.
ðŽ Scientific Significance
Studying mammoth skeletons provides invaluable insights into the biology, behavior, and extinction of these majestic creatures. For instance, the Warren Mastodon, discovered in Newburgh, New York, in 1845, is one of the most complete mastodon skeletons ever found. It was preserved in the position it died, offering scientists a rare opportunity to study its final moments.
ð Global Exhibits
Mammoth skeletons are showcased in various museums worldwide, allowing the public to connect with Earth's ancient history. For example, the Mammoth Site in South Dakota has been excavating mammoth fossils for over 50 years, uncovering remains from at least 61 mammoths.

ð FlÃĨm Railway, Vestland, Norway
Embark on one of the world's most scenic train journeys aboard the FlÃĨm Railway (FlÃĨmsbana), a 20.2 km route that descends 866 meters from Myrdal to FlÃĨm. Recognized by Lonely Planet as the world's most beautiful train ride, this route offers unparalleled views of cascading waterfalls, lush valleys, and towering mountains.
Highlights include the majestic Kjosfossen waterfall, where the train pauses to let passengers admire the 225-meter drop and, during summer, witness a mythical Huldra dance performance.

ð Lake Geneva & Jet dâEau, Geneva, Switzerland
Experience the enchanting evening atmosphere along the shores of Lake Geneva, where the iconic Jet dâEauâa towering fountain shooting water 140 m high at 200 km/hâilluminates the twilight sky with a mesmerizing glow.
As the sun sets, the lake reflects the city lights, creating a dreamy scene perfect for evening strolls, romantic cruises, or simply soaking in Genevaâs serene elegance.
Nearby, stroll through Jardin Anglais to admire the famous Horloge Fleurie, or take a glass-wine cruise to savor the cityscape from the water as night falls.

ð Library of Congress, Main Reading Room, Washington, DC, USA
ðïļ A Dome of Enlightenment
This breathtaking interior is the Thomas Jefferson Building's Main Reading Room, crowned by a coffered dome soaring 160 ft above an octagonal hall framed by eight marble piers and towering Corinthian columns. At its heart is the domeâs lantern, where Edwin Blashfieldâs âHuman Understandingâ is depicted lifting the veil of ignorance amid cherubs and 12 allegorical figures representing the evolution of civilizationsâfrom Egypt to America.
ðŋ Guardians of Wisdom
Surrounding the dome are colossal statues personifying Religion, Philosophy, Art, Law, Science, Commerce, History, and Poetry, with bronze likenesses of iconic thinkers on the gallery balustradeâmirroring America's reverence for human thought. The Great Hall beneath captivates with stained-glass skylights, zodiac marble flooring, aluminumâleaf ceilings, and winged âgeniusâ figures symbolizing learning and inspiration.

ð Julian Alps Trail, Slovenia
This stunning Alpine trail winds through the heart of the Julian Alps, from emerald-valley foothills to rugged limestone peaks topped by snow. It follows historic routes like the VrÅĄiÄ Pass, carved during World War I, and runs through Triglav National Park, Sloveniaâs sole national park, home to glacial lakes, waterfalls, and rare wildlife.
Part of longer itineraries like the Slovenian Mountain Hiking Trailâan 599 km route with 80 control pointsâand the transnational AlpeâAdria or Via Alpina, these trails offer deeply immersive experiences in nature and culture.
Hikers encounter soaring peaks such as Triglav and Mangart, serene meadows blooming with wildflowers, and mountain huts where regional folklore and hospitality thrive.

ð Library of Congress, Washington, DC, USA
A marvel of art, architecture, and intellect, the Library of Congress stands as the largest library in the worldâan enduring emblem of Americaâs commitment to knowledge. The Thomas Jefferson Building, completed in 1897, radiates grandeur with its Beaux-Arts façade, Corinthian columns, and the majestic âTorch of Knowledgeâ dome. Inside, gilded mosaics, marble staircases, and mural-filled halls invite visitors into a world where history and beauty converge.
